Transaction 1912fda01b72e6839d344e124bb23657764c566c757fdd786961fedc8774e352

1 Input
2 Outputs
  • 1912fda01b72e6839d344e124bb23657764c566c757fdd786961fedc8774e352:0
  • value  7000000
    address  1JD1kNvs2Vn79ESAhu4TNf5sgLKhWwrWe7
  • 1912fda01b72e6839d344e124bb23657764c566c757fdd786961fedc8774e352:1
  • value  1163338241
    address  3HFuP6r5JAeaSsMSQrtFoKHzPTT9cEAc3e